On Thursday, May 30, Mr. Richard L. Armitage visited the ÎçÒ¹¾ç³¡ Global Research Institute (KGRI), which has entered its third year of operations, for the implementation of the "Richard Lee Armitage Commemorative Program: Building New Foundations for a Robust Japan-United States Relationship" (Armitage Program). The Project Leader for the Armitage Program is Motohiro Tsuchiya, Vice Director of the ÎçÒ¹¾ç³¡ Global Research Institute (KGRI) and Professor at the Graduate School of Media and Governance.

Mr. Armitage had an informal audience with Professor David Farber, Distinguished Professor and Co-Director of the Cyber Civilization Research Center, which has been established within KGRI. The Project Leader for the Cyber Civilization Research Center is Jiro Koruryo, one of ÎçÒ¹¾ç³¡'s Vice-Presidents and Professor at the Faculty of Policy Management.
